The Opportunity Happy Mammoth is looking for a Team Lead, E-commerce to own the entire digital commercial engine across our Shopify Plus stores (US, EU, AU) and Amazon marketplace. This is not a "manage the website" role. You will be directly responsible for on-site revenue performance, funnel development, compliance governance, and technical stability across every revenue-generating digital property we operate. About Happy Mammoth Happy Mammoth is a fast-growing natural health company formulating, producing, and marketing gut health and hormone-balancing supplements to millions of customers across Australia, the United States, and Europe. We operate direct-to-consumer through Shopify Plus and Amazon, with deep roots in performance marketing and direct response. This is a company built on speed, testing, and commercial results. The Role You will lead the e-commerce function and own six critical outcome areas: - Conversion & Commercial Execution - You own on-site commercial performance across all Happy Mammoth stores and the Amazon marketplace. Your job is to protect and grow Revenue per Visitor and marketplace conversion rates. - Funnel & Page Development System - You own the creation, deployment, and optimization of funnels, landing pages, PDPs, and commercial flows. You set the direction, brief designers and developers, and drive the cycle time from approved brief to live deployment down while keeping quality high. You define and oversee structured A/B testing, ensure performance validation before scaling, and monitor post-launch impact. Every new page or funnel should either prove a hypothesis or improve a metric. - Product Launches & Special Campaigns - You lead the commercial execution of new product launches and seasonal or promotional campaigns. You direct designers and developers to build the launch funnels, landing pages, and supporting assets, set the creative direction, coordinate timing with the paid media team, and ensure every launch is set up for measurable success from day one. - Brand & Design Consistency + SEO - You are the quality gate for brand and design alignment across all customer-facing digital properties. Every store, funnel, product page, and marketplace listing must be visually and tonally consistent. You also own on-page and technical SEO across all stores - site structure, metadata, schema markup, and crawlability - ensuring storefronts capture organic traffic, not just paid. - Compliance & Regulatory Control - You own the process of ensuring all stores, funnels, and marketplace listings are compliant. You work closely with the legal team to ensure that pages, claims, and product content meet regional regulatory requirements across all markets before and after launch. You do not need to be a regulatory expert, but you need to build and enforce the systems that ensure compliance is checked, maintained, and never an afterthought. Zero tolerance for post-launch compliance fires that could have been prevented - Store Stability & Technical Performance - You own functional reliability and operational excellence across all digital properties. Site speed, checkout performance, tracking integrity, and platform stability are your responsibility. You direct your development team to prevent performance degradation after updates or releases. If the checkout breaks or load times spike, you own the resolution - diagnosing the issue, directing the fix, and ensuring it does not happen again What We’re Looking For You have senior-level experience running e-commerce operations in a direct-to-consumer environment, ideally in health, supplements, or a similarly regulated vertical. You understand Shopify Plus deeply, not just as a user but as someone who has overseen store architecture, checkout optimization, and multi-store operations at scale. You are fluent in funnel metrics: CVR, AOV, RPV, LTV, and CAC are part of your daily vocabulary. You have directed the creation and optimization of landing pages, PDPs, and commercial funnels, and you have overseen structured A/B testing programs with measurable results. You understand how compliance works in regulated industries. You do not need to be a regulatory expert, but you have experience working with legal teams to ensure content is compliant, and you know how to build systems that prevent compliance issues from slipping through. You are technically sharp. You can read site speed reports, diagnose checkout issues, and direct developers to fix problems - not just file tickets and wait. You move fast, make decisions with imperfect information, and take full ownership of outcomes. You set direction for your team and hold them accountable for execution. You do not need to be told what to do. You see the problem, diagnose it, and mobilize the right people to fix it. This is a hands-on role. You are expected to be directly involved in execution — not just defining strategy, but driving implementation and results. Your team You will lead a cross-functional team of developers and marketplace specialists, with additional support from design, copy, and project management. You report directly to the Head of Growth. Nice to Have - Experience in DTC brands. - Experience in supplements, health, or wellness. - Familiarity with CRO and analytics tools. - Experience in performance marketing. - Experience managing multi-region Shopify Plus stores.
